Description

The Security Team discovered an integer overflow bug that allows an attacker with code execution to issue memory cache invalidation operations on pages that they don’t own, allowing them to control kernel memory from userspace. We recommend upgrading to kernel version 4.1 or beyond.

VendorProductVersions

Google LLC

Fuchsia Kernel

affected
unspecified - < 4.1
